Stopping the Click

Finally I stopped an annoying clicking sound on my mountain bike. It only happened when I pedaled under load. Here's what I did to stop it (using http://www.jimlangley.net/wrench/keepitquiet.htm):

  • Removed the water bottle cage and all other bolts in the frame and greased them up.
  • Re-greased the seat post and seat post bolt
  • Loosened the front derailleur clamp and greased it up
  • Put a dab of chain lube on each part of the frame that the shifter cables run through
  • Bought new pedals (Candy 2s :)
  • Bought a new bottom bracket (noticed mine had some slight side-to-side play in it)
  • Used teflon tape on the threads of the new BB
  • Removed each chain ring bolt and applied some loc-tite
  • Removed the crank arms and greased them (octa-link... never do this to square taper!)
  • Finally, I sprayed silicon lube on the right crank arm where it is in contact with the large chain ring. That did the trick!
